Freshest News: The Most Heretical Last Boss Queen: From Villainess to Savior anime and Who Made Me a Princess licensed by Seven Seas

The Most Heretical Last Boss Queen: From Villainess to Savior (Higeki no Genkyō to naru Saikyō Gedō Last Boss Joō wa Min no tame ni Tsukushimasu.) light novel will be adapted into anime. It is slated to air in July 2023. Source: ANN Pride Royal Ivy is only eight years old when she realizes that she's been reincarnated, destined to become the future wicked queen and final boss of an otome game. She's got it all in this new life: razor-sharp wit, boss-tier powers, and influence over the kingdom as crown princess. Determined to sow despair and destruction across the land, she... Wait, what kind of a rotten future is that?! Princess Pride decides to drop the maniacal villainess plan and protect the male love interests instead, cheating her way to saving everyone she can! Will this final boss end up earning the adoration of her kingdom? The manga adaptation was also recently cancelled due to the bad health of the artist. First Impression: Bibliophile Princess Eps 1-3

  Seventeen-year-old Elianna Bernstein is known as the Bibliophile Princess for her great love of reading books. After four years, she can sense her pretend engagement with Lord Christopher is about to be broken off.  Last year, I was able to read the source materials before the anime aired for The Saint's Magic is Omnipotent and Pretty Boy Detective Club. But this year, with the current reverse harem reviews backlog, I've decided to just wait for the anime to air starting with Bibliophile Princess.   T he first three episodes felt like the last three episodes in a series without ever knowing what happened from episodes 1 to 9.  Meanwhile, the romance gears are moving at a much faster pace compared to usual stories but... I don't feel that I'm there yet . There's no reason to hate it but I have yet to find a solid reason to love it. But there's a feeling of certainty that we'll be given more reasons to love it. Anime Review: Uta no Prince-sama Maji Love Starish Tours : Tabi no Hajimari and First Impressions: Love Like the Galaxy, To X Who Doesn't Love Me and Tokyo Mew Mew New

Uta no Prince-sama  Maji Love ST☆RISH Tours: Tabi no Hajimari (The Journey Begins)- TV special - 47 mins runtime It takes place after the success of the concert of three groups: Starish, Quartet Night and Heavens, in the Uta no Prince Sama Maji Love Kingdom (the last film) which will then lead up to the decision of Starish's concert tour on  Uta no Prince-sama  Maji Love Starish Tours  (upcoming film). See previous reviews Since this is a short TV special, it's reasonable to lump it with the 'First Impressions". Nothing fancy schmancy just them boys finally having the time to be together after becoming busy with different idol activities. But the question is will Nanami make an appearance? I will let you find it out for yourself.  Starting from Uta no Prince Sama Maji Love Kingdom, the franchise had to grow out from the reverse harem it was also known for. Freshest News: The World You are Missing key visuals and new PV, Kimi no Hana ni Naru on Netflix, UtaPri film earns 1B yen and more!

Check out key visuals and a new promotional video from The World You are Missing. It will be out on October 20 and will have a simultaneous release on Netflix but not confirmed if it's a worldwide release. Source: official Youtube  (Not a confirmed reverse harem) Kimi no Hana ni Naru gets a worldwide release on Netflix a day after it airs in Japan on October 18. It will be released progressively for various countries. Source: Natalie via Doramaworld   (Not a confirmed reverse harem) Uta no prince Sama Maji Love Starish Tours film earned 1 billion yen (about 6.92M USD) or 629,000 tickets as of its 33rd day at Japan's box office. Source: ANN The final chapter of  "Multiending Arc" of La Corda d'Oro Collge Arc (Kin-iro no Corda Daigakusei-hen) was published in the November issue of Lala DX. Manga Review: I was Reincarnated as the Villainess in an Otome Game but the Boys Love Me Anyway! Vol. 3

I was Reincarnated as the Villainess in an Otome Game but the Boys Love Me Anyway! Vol. 3 by Shou (Akuyaku Reijou Desu ga, Kouyaku Taishou no Yousu ga Ijou Sugiru) Manga by: Ataka Light novel: by Sou Inaida Art by: Hachipsu Wen Mystia is trying to stop the events that will lead to her end. But meanwhile, the events that she's anticipating are also not happening! It's all because of her doing, of course. And there's something sinister pulling the strings in the background. Check out Volumes 1 to 2 reviews . Disclaimer: A review copy was provided by the publisher. Something I forgot to mention from the start is that the setting of the story is European historical vibe but the highschool look is modern Japan. The game story proper of KyunKyun Love School takes place in highschool.  But it's not your sweet, light highschool life.
